The most recent inspection on September 30, 2024, found no deficiencies and the complaint was not substantiated. Earlier inspections showed a pattern of deficiencies related mainly to medication administration errors, documentation issues, and safety concerns such as hazards on exit walkways and improper food storage. Complaint investigations prior to the latest inspection were generally unsubstantiated, with no enforcement actions or fines listed in the available reports. Plans of correction were accepted and implemented for all cited deficiencies in prior inspections. The facility appears to be improving, as recent complaint investigations and the latest inspection found no deficiencies.

The legal owner and operator of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own is The New Heritage Towers Inc.
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own has a walk score of 94. Walker's paradise. Daily errands do not require a car, with many shops and services nearby.
According to PA state health department records,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own's license number is 127180.
According to PA state health department records,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own's license expires on July 5, 2026.
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own's occupancy is 71%.
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own is registered as a non-profit in PA.
Wesley Enhanced Living Doylestown has 75 beds.
